Autonomous Growing nomination for Delphy Digital

The jury has selected Delphy Digital as one of the six nominated from the twenty-six submissions.

Unmanned Growing Concepts

The nominees for the 2nd edition of the Top Sector T&U Innovation Prize have been announced. Delphy Digital has been nominated for the “Innovation Prize 2020 – Unmanned Growing Concepts”, which is again organized this year by Top Sector T&U and TU Delft. On October 6, the nominees will present a pitch to the jury and the public, after which the public can vote until October 23, when the winner will be announced.

With autonomous growing, according to the jury, Delphy has proposed an innovation that demonstrably contributes to the further development of “unmanned growing concepts”. Automation and robotization are important for horticulture. The unmanned growing concept of Delphy Digital helps greenhouse vegetables growers worldwide by making autonomous decisions about climate, irrigation and crop control. Our team works on technology which makes it possible to meet the increasing demand for high quality fresh food and an increasing lack of people who know how to grow this food.
